Rülzheim, Rhineland-Palatinate, Germany

Overview

Rülzheim is a charming small town in Rhineland-Palatinate, known for its friendly community, historic center, and lush landscapes. With its traditional German architecture and proximity to beautiful nature parks, the town is perfect for a relaxed rural stay or as a base for exploring the surrounding Palatinate region.

Best Time to Visit

April-June for pleasant spring weather and local festivals, or September for harvest celebrations.

Local Tips

Most shops close early in the evening and on Sundays; the train station offers direct connections to Karlsruhe and Germersheim. Consider renting bikes for exploring nearby natural areas.

Cultural Etiquette

Tipping is appreciated, round up or leave 5-10%. Dress is casual but tidy. Greet people with a polite 'Guten Tag', and be mindful of quiet hours (especially Sundays).

Safety Warnings

Rülzheim is generally very safe, with low crime rates. Watch out for rural traffic and cyclists. No tourist-targeted scams reported.

Hidden Gems

Discover the local forest trails, the historic water tower, and Café Nostalgie, a retro-themed family cafe popular with locals.
